The Rise of Digital Pokies
As technology advanced in the 1970s and 1980s, pokies began to undergo a transformation. The introduction of electronic components and microprocessors allowed for more complex gameplay and graphics. This led to the development of the first video slots, which offered improved sound and visual effects compared to their mechanical predecessors.
One of the most significant changes in this period was the addition of multiple pay lines. With the advancement of technology, it became possible to have up to 50 or more pay lines on a single machine, increasing the number of potential winning combinations and making the games more exciting and engaging.
The Introduction of Bonus Games and Features
To make the games even more entertaining, software developers began experimenting with bonus games and features. These added elements provided players with additional chances to win and increased the overall excitement of playing pokies. Some of the early bonus games included free spins, where players received extra spins at no cost, and pick-em bonuses, where players had to choose items to reveal prizes.
The inclusion of bonus games also encouraged players to try different strategies, such as targeting specific symbols or aiming for particular combinations to trigger these bonuses. This added a layer of complexity and depth to the gameplay, making it more intriguing and rewarding for players.
The Spread of Pokies Around the World
As pokies evolved, they also began to spread globally. With the growth of international tourism and the increasing accessibility of casinos, pokies gained popularity in new markets. This led to adaptations being made to suit local cultures and preferences, with different themes, symbols, and bonus features being introduced to cater to diverse player tastes.
For example, in Australia and New Zealand, where poker machines are particularly popular, the games often feature sport-themed designs, reflecting the importance of sports culture in these countries. Similarly, in Europe, pokies with classic themes and a more sophisticated look and feel tend to appeal to players.
The Impact of Technology on Pokies Design
The advent of the internet and online gambling brought about another significant evolution in pokies design. Online pokies allowed players to access their favorite games from the comfort of their homes, and the industry quickly boomed. Software developers raced to create innovative games with improved graphics, sound effects, and interactive features.
Online pokies offered a more diverse range of themes, stories, and bonus rounds, capturing the imagination of players worldwide. The ability to play on mobile devices also opened up new possibilities, with pokies now available on smartphones and tablets, providing convenience and accessibility like never before.
